Basic rules

There are basic rules of idn poker that all players need to know in order to be able to play the game. When choosing a hand, the most important factor is position. This is because position determines the seat that you will have after the flop. It will also determine your position on later streets. Late positions are advantageous because they give you more options for bluffing and stealing blinds. One of the best positions in poker is the button. This is the position that is last to act after the flop and can see the other players’ decisions. As a result, you will need to adjust your opening ranges based on position.

Betting

Betting on poker is a skill that can be developed through experience and by observing other players. As the game progresses, you must adjust your betting strategy to keep up with the new trends. For example, you must figure out why players make certain bets, such as limping, calling the blind, or over-betting when the flop does not offer any high cards.
